Using Mix Tiles is a simple process designed to easily display your photos on your walls without nails or tools. They adhere using a special sticky backing that allows for easy placement and repositioning.

Getting Started with Your Mix Tiles

Mix Tiles are essentially printed photos on lightweight foam boards with an adhesive strip on the back. This unique design makes them perfect for creating personalized wall art galleries quickly and easily.

Step-by-Step Guide to Hanging Mix Tiles

Hanging your Mix Tiles is straightforward. Follow these steps for the best results:

  1. Plan Your Layout: Before you stick anything to the wall, decide where to stick your tile. This is a crucial first step referenced in tutorials, as it allows you to visualize your arrangement and make adjustments without wasting the adhesive. Arrange the tiles on the floor or hold them up against the wall in different configurations.
  2. Prepare the Wall: Ensure the wall surface is clean, dry, and smooth for optimal adhesion. Wipe away any dust or debris.
  3. Determine Spacing: Use a measuring tool to get even spaces between your tiles. This helps create a clean, professional look for your display. You can use a ruler, level, or even a piece of paper cut to the desired width.
  4. Peel and Stick: Once you are happy with the planned position and spacing, peel the protective paper off the sticky backing of the first tile. The reference explicitly mentions doing this after deciding the placement so the adhesive won't dry out.
  5. Apply to the Wall: Carefully press the tile firmly against the wall in your chosen spot.
  6. Repeat: Continue with the remaining tiles, using your spacing guide to maintain consistency between them.

Tips for Best Results

  • Test the Spot: Although Mix Tiles are designed to be repositionable, it's a good idea to lightly touch the adhesive to the wall first to confirm the position before pressing firmly.
  • Use a Level: While not strictly necessary for every arrangement, using a level can ensure your tiles are perfectly straight, especially for grid layouts.
  • Clean Adhesive: If you need to reposition a tile, the adhesive strip is usually designed to be reapplied multiple times without losing its stickiness, provided the wall surface is clean.
